What Is Type 2 Diabetes, and Why Does It Happen?
Type 2 diabetes is a condition where your body cannot keep blood sugar levels where they should be. Here’s the mechanism behind it: insulin is a hormone made by your pancreas, and its job is to unlock your cells so glucose can move out of your blood and into the cells, where it gets used as fuel. In type 2 diabetes, your cells stop responding to insulin properly — doctors call this insulin resistance. Because the cells resist the signal, glucose stays stuck in your bloodstream instead of moving where it’s needed. Your pancreas tries to compensate by pumping out more insulin, and over years, this overwork can tire it out, so it slowly makes less insulin too. That’s how high blood sugar becomes a worsening problem instead of a one-time spike.
Type 1 vs Type 2 Diabetes
- Type 1 diabetes: An autoimmune condition. The immune system attacks and destroys the insulin-making cells in the pancreas. A person with type 1 makes little to no insulin at all and needs insulin injections for life, usually starting in childhood or early adulthood.
- Type 2 diabetes: The pancreas still makes insulin, at least at first. The real problem is that the body’s cells don’t respond to it well. It develops slowly, over years, and is closely tied to weight, diet, and activity, though genetics plays a role too.
This difference matters for reversal. You cannot reverse a condition where the insulin-making cells are already destroyed. Type 2 diabetes reversal is only possible because, in many cases, the insulin-making machinery is still there it’s the response to insulin that needs fixing.
What About Prediabetes?
Prediabetes sits between healthy blood sugar and full type 2 diabetes:
- Fasting blood sugar: 100–125 mg/dL
- HbA1c: 5.7%–6.4%
This stage matters because it’s your best window to act. Weight loss and lifestyle changes at the prediabetes stage can often stop type 2 diabetes from developing at all.
What Causes Type 2 Diabetes?
There’s rarely a single cause usually a mix of the following, working together over time:
- Excess weight, especially around the waist fat near the liver and pancreas directly interferes with how well insulin works
- Sedentary lifestyle — unused muscles become less efficient at pulling glucose out of the blood
- Family history — having a parent or sibling with type 2 diabetes raises your own risk
- Age over 45 — risk climbs noticeably with age
- Ethnic background — South Asian, African-American, Latino, and Pacific Islander populations carry higher genetic predisposition
- Gestational diabetes or PCOS — both raise a woman’s lifetime risk
- Chronic stress or poor sleep — can quietly push blood sugar up over time
Symptoms of Type 2 Diabetes
Type 2 diabetes tends to creep in quietly. Many people live with it for years before diagnosis because the symptoms feel like ordinary tiredness or ageing.
Watch for:
- Constant thirst that doesn’t go away
- Frequent urination, especially at night
- Tiredness that doesn’t lift even after rest
- Blurred vision
- Cuts or wounds that take unusually long to heal
- Frequent infections
- Unexplained weight loss
- Darkened skin around the neck, armpits, or groin (called acanthosis nigricans, caused directly by high insulin levels)
It also helps to know what a blood sugar swing feels like, since sugar can go too low as well as too high, especially once someone starts medication.
- Low blood sugar (hypoglycemia): shakiness, sudden sweating, fast heartbeat, hunger, dizziness, irritability
- High blood sugar (hyperglycemia): thirst, fatigue, blurred vision, frequent urination
Knowing the difference matters, because the two need very different immediate responses.
Busting the Biggest Myths About Diabetes Reversal
Myth: Reversal means you are cured forever.
Not quite. What most people call “reversal” is medically known as remission blood sugar returns to a non-diabetic range and stays there for at least three months, without medication. But the underlying tendency toward insulin resistance doesn’t disappear. If weight is regained or old habits creep back, blood sugar can rise again.
Myth: Only extreme diets can reverse diabetes.
Not true. Losing even 5% to 10% of body weight can meaningfully improve insulin sensitivity and blood sugar control. You don’t need a drastic transformation to see real change.
Myth: Needing medication means you’ve failed.
This is one of the most damaging myths out there. Medication is a tool, not a punishment. Some people’s pancreas and insulin resistance need extra support, and that has nothing to do with effort or willpower.
Myth: Reversal works the same for everyone.
It doesn’t. People who achieve remission most often share a few traits diagnosed more recently, achieved significant and sustained weight loss, and still had reasonably good pancreatic function at diagnosis. Someone who’s had high blood sugar for fifteen years has a much harder road to remission than someone diagnosed last year.
How Is Type 2 Diabetes Diagnosed?
- Fasting blood glucose test: checks sugar after not eating for hours; above 125 mg/dL points to diabetes
- Random blood glucose test: no fasting needed; above 200 mg/dL is diagnostic
- HbA1c test: estimates average blood sugar over the past two to three months rather than a single moment, giving doctors a bigger-picture view; above 6.5% confirms diabetes, 5.7%–6.4% points to prediabetes
Can Type 2 Diabetes Actually Be Reversed?
Yes, for many people but with an important caveat: what’s achieved is remission, not a permanent cure. When someone loses a meaningful amount of weight, especially the fat stored around the liver and pancreas, insulin sensitivity genuinely improves. Regular activity adds to this by making muscle tissue more efficient at absorbing glucose, so less insulin is needed to do the same job. Some research also points to the gut microbiome playing a role — a healthier balance of gut bacteria, supported by fibre-rich foods, probiotics, and prebiotics, appears to improve how the body handles blood sugar, though this area is still being studied.
Complete reversal, where blood sugar stays normal indefinitely without any further effort, is rare. What’s far more common and still genuinely valuable is remission that lasts as long as the lifestyle changes are maintained.
How to Manage or Work Toward Reversing Type 2 Diabetes
Diet: Cut down on refined sugar and processed carbs. Build meals around vegetables, whole grains like oats and brown rice, lean protein, and healthy fats such as nuts and olive oil. Low-carb and low-calorie approaches have both shown strong results, but no single diet works identically for everyone work with a doctor or dietitian to find what fits your life.
Exercise: Aim for around 150 minutes of moderate activity a week brisk walking, cycling, swimming plus some strength training. Exercise makes your muscles pull glucose out of the blood more efficiently, and this effect lasts around two to three days after a single session, which is why consistency matters more than intensity.
Weight loss: Even a 5% to 10% drop in body weight often shows up as real improvement in fasting blood sugar and insulin sensitivity. Crash diets rarely hold up long-term.
Intermittent fasting: Some studies suggest structured fasting periods can reduce fat stored in the liver and pancreas, improving insulin sensitivity. This isn’t right for everyone, especially those already on blood-sugar-lowering medication, so it needs medical supervision.
Medication, when your doctor recommends it:
- Metformin — usually the first medicine prescribed; tells the liver to stop overproducing glucose
- GLP-1 agonists — slow digestion and help you feel full sooner
- SGLT2 inhibitors — help the kidneys flush out extra glucose through urine
- Metabolic/bariatric surgery — an option for significant obesity; research shows it can lead to remission in a meaningful number of cases
Care team: Managing type 2 diabetes well usually works best with more than one professional — your regular doctor, an endocrinologist for hormone-specific guidance, a dietitian for nutrition, and a diabetes educator for day-to-day monitoring support.
Can You Stop Diabetes Medication After Remission?
Some people do reach a point where their doctor reduces or stops medication, but this decision should never be made alone. Your doctor will look at blood sugar trends, HbA1c, how long you’ve had diabetes, and overall health before deciding it’s safe to cut back. Stopping medication on your own, even after weeks of great readings, can cause a dangerous rebound. Regular monitoring stays important even after remission, since diabetes can return quietly if old patterns creep back in.
What Happens If Type 2 Diabetes Is Left Untreated?
When blood sugar stays high for years without proper management, the excess glucose slowly damages blood vessels and nerves throughout the body. This is why untreated diabetes is linked to:
- Heart disease — damaged blood vessels raise the risk of heart attacks and stroke
- Kidney disease — the kidneys’ filtering vessels get damaged over time, potentially leading to kidney failure
- Diabetic eye disease — small blood vessels in the eyes are especially vulnerable, making diabetic retinopathy a leading cause of vision loss
- Nerve damage (neuropathy) — often shows up first as tingling or numbness in the feet, and can lead to wounds that don’t heal properly
- Diabetic ketoacidosis — a dangerous emergency that can happen when blood sugar spikes extremely high, suddenly
Living with diabetes can also affect mental health the day-to-day burden of managing the condition is linked to higher rates of anxiety and depression, which is worth mentioning to your doctor if it’s affecting you.
Can Type 2 Diabetes Be Prevented?
This might be the most encouraging part of the whole picture. Unlike type 1 diabetes, type 2 diabetes can often be delayed or prevented entirely, especially if caught at the prediabetes stage. One large, well-known study called the Diabetes Prevention Program found that people who made consistent diet and exercise changes lowered their risk of developing diabetes by 58%. People over 60 saw even bigger benefits, cutting their risk by 71%. For comparison, people who took the medication metformin for prevention only reduced their risk by 31% proof that lifestyle changes, while harder, are genuinely more powerful here than a pill alone.
Practical steps that lower your risk:
- Reach and maintain a healthy weight
- Stay physically active most days of the week
- Eat a diet built around whole foods rather than processed ones
- Don’t smoke
- Keep alcohol intake moderate
If you already have prediabetes, these same steps can be the difference between staying there and progressing to full type 2 diabetes.

FAQ Section:
1. Can type 2 diabetes really be reversed?
For many people, yes, in the sense of remission blood sugar returns to a non-diabetic range without medication. Complete, permanent reversal is rare, and remission needs to be maintained through ongoing healthy habits.
2. How much weight loss is needed to reverse type 2 diabetes?
Losing 5% to 10% of your body weight is often enough to significantly improve insulin sensitivity and blood sugar control, though more sustained weight loss tends to improve the odds of full remission.
3. Can diabetes be managed without medication?
Some people manage it through diet, exercise, and weight loss alone, especially if diagnosed early. Others need medication alongside lifestyle changes, and that is not a sign of failure.
4. What is the difference between diabetes remission and a cure?
Remission means blood sugar has returned to normal without medication for at least three months. A cure would mean the condition never returns, which is not currently considered accurate for type 2 diabetes, since blood sugar can rise again if habits change.
5. Can prediabetes be reversed?
Yes, and it is often easier to reverse than full type 2 diabetes. Weight loss and lifestyle changes at the prediabetes stage can frequently bring blood sugar back to a healthy range and prevent progression.
6. What foods should I avoid with type 2 diabetes?
Highly processed foods, sugary drinks, refined white bread, pastries, and foods high in added sugar tend to spike blood sugar quickly and should be limited.
